How To Fix FMHIE109 - Subordinate data of the node &1&2 has to be read from database


FMHIE109 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FMHIE - Budget Hierarchies

  • Message number: 109

  • Message text: Subordinate data of the node &1&2 has to be read from database

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The system needs to process the subordinates of the node &v1&&v2& from
    the database to finish the action.

    System Response

    Processing stops.

    How to fix this error?

    Read the sub-tree for the hierarchy node &v1&&v2& from the database.

FMHIE109 - Details

  • The SAP error message FMHIE109 indicates that there is an issue with reading subordinate data for a specific node in the context of hierarchical data structures, such as those used in Funds Management (FM) or other modules that utilize hierarchical data.
    
    Cause: The error typically occurs when the system is unable to retrieve the subordinate data for a specified node from the database. This can happen due to several reasons, including: Data Inconsistency: The data in the database may be inconsistent or corrupted, leading to the inability to fetch the required subordinate data. Missing Data: The subordinate data for the specified node may not exist in the database.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the subordinate data. Database Issues: There may be issues with the database connection or performance, causing timeouts or failures in data retrieval.
